Synopsis

The microscope is an optical instrument which is used to visualize and magnify detail, to measure length, angles and area of an object, and to determine refractive index, reflectance and phase change. This introduction to the optical microscope has been designed for clinicians with little or no knowledge of the instrument. It details the construction and principal components of the microscope and discusses the theory behind its workings. The text provides step-by-step guidance for the production of clear images and advice on instrument care.
